The Bentley Continental GT is a grand tourer produced by the British luxury automaker Bentley. The Continental GT's history dates back to the early 2000s, when Bentley was looking to create a new flagship model that would showcase the brand's heritage and craftsmanship.
The first generation Continental GT was unveiled at the 2002 Paris Motor Show. Designed by Dirk van Braeckel, the Continental GT was a sleek and powerful grand tourer that was inspired by the classic Bentleys of the 1950s and 1960s. The car featured a 6.0-liter twin-turbo W12 engine that produced 552 horsepower, making it one of the fastest production cars in the world at the time.
The Continental GT was an instant success, thanks to its stunning design, exceptional performance, and luxurious interior. The car quickly became a status symbol among the wealthy and famous, with celebrities like Jay Leno and Elton John among its early owners.
In 2005, Bentley introduced the Continental GTC, a convertible version of the Continental GT. The GTC featured a retractable soft top and a more relaxed, open-air driving experience.
In 2007, Bentley updated the Continental GT with a new Mulliner Driving Specification package, which added a range of performance and styling upgrades to the car. The package included a sport-tuned suspension, unique 20-inch wheels, and a range of interior trim options.
In 2010, Bentley introduced the second generation Continental GT. The new car featured a more aggressive and angular design, with a new front grille, LED headlights, and a more sloping roofline. The car also featured a range of new technologies, including a new eight-speed automatic transmission and a more advanced all-wheel-drive system.
In 2012, Bentley introduced the Continental GT V8, a new variant of the Continental GT that featured a more efficient 4.0-liter twin-turbo V8 engine. The V8 engine produced 500 horsepower and 487 lb-ft of torque, making it one of the most powerful V8 engines in the world.
In 2015, Bentley introduced the Continental GT Speed, a high-performance variant of the Continental GT that featured a more powerful 6.0-liter twin-turbo W12 engine. The Speed model produced 626 horsepower and 607 lb-ft of torque, making it one of the fastest production cars in the world.
In 2018, Bentley introduced the third generation Continental GT. The new car featured a more sleek and aerodynamic design, with a new front grille, LED headlights, and a more sloping roofline. The car also featured a range of new technologies, including a new eight-speed dual-clutch transmission and a more advanced all-wheel-drive system.
Today, the Bentley Continental GT is one of the most iconic and desirable luxury cars in the world. With its stunning design, exceptional performance, and luxurious interior, the Continental GT is the ultimate grand tourer for those who demand the very best.
